Although the efforts to desegregate the schools haven’t been uniformly successful, de jure segregation in public colleges—the practice addressed particularly in Brown—doesn’t exist within the United States at present. However, the goal of creating an built-in public-school system has not been achieved. Most minority children still attend schools where they’re the majority of students, or the place their numbers are disproportionately excessive, as in comparison with the realm inhabitants.

However, so as to show liability, the plaintiff should present that the school had notice of a pattern of unconstitutional conduct. For example, a handful of complaints received by varied faculty officers that a bus driver had kissed or fondled several handicapped kids were inadequate to help a Section 1983 declare (Jane Doe A v. Special School Dist. of St. Louis County, 908 F.second 642, 60 Ed. The case arose when a schoolteacher in Talladega, Alabama, suspected that two second-grade girls had stolen money from a classmate. The instructor, together with a steerage counselor, subjected the girls to two strip searches in the ladies’ restroom on the school. The parents of the youngsters later brought an motion alleging that the teachers had violated the girls’ rights under the First and Fourteenth Amendments of the U.S.
